Immediate Steps to Take After an Injury at the Museum

Visitors should take the following steps if they are hurt at the Capitol Park Museum:

  • Notify museum staff immediately: Inform staff or security personnel about the accident so they can document the incident and provide assistance.
  • Seek medical attention: Get evaluated by medical professionals, even if your injuries appear minor. Some conditions may not show symptoms right away.
  • Document the scene: Take photos of the area where the accident occurred, any hazards, and your injuries.
  • Gather witness information: Obtain contact details from anyone who saw the incident occur.
  • Keep records: Save medical records, receipts, and any correspondence with the museum or its insurance company.

Common Accidents at Museums

Some common accidents that occur at places like the Capitol Park Museum include:

  • Slip and falls: Wet floors, uneven surfaces, and poor lighting can cause visitors to slip, trip, or fall.
  • Falling objects: Improperly secured exhibits or decorations may fall and injure visitors.
  • Elevator and escalator accidents: Malfunctioning equipment can cause injuries to users.
  • Negligent security: Lack of adequate security measures can lead to assaults or other harm.

Liability for Museum Injuries in Louisiana

In Louisiana, property owners and operators, including museums, owe a duty of care to lawful visitors. When they fail to keep the premises reasonably safe and someone is injured, they may be held liable under premises liability law.

Louisiana follows a pure comparative fault system, which means that if you are found partially at fault for the accident,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ault.

Filing a Personal Injury Claim After a Museum Accident

Victims of accidents at the Capitol Park Museum can pursue compensation by filing a personal injury claim. This process generally involves investigating the accident to identify hazards and liable parties, collecting evidence, calculating damages, negotiating with the museum’s insurance company for a fair settlement, and filing a lawsuit if the insurance company refuses to offer adequate compensation.

Time Limits for Filing a Claim in Louisiana

Louisiana has a short statute of limitations for personal injury claims. Under Louisiana law, you generally have two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it. Failing to file within this period can result in losing your right to compensation.
